### Browser sign-in (`--oauth`)
|
|
47
|
+
|
|
48
|
+
`cargo-ai login --oauth` runs the standard [OAuth 2.0 Device Authorization Flow](https://datatracker.ietf.org/doc/html/rfc8628) (similar UX to `gh auth login`) against the Cargo OAuth provider, prints a verification URL and user code, opens your default browser, and polls until you complete sign-in. On success the access token is written to `~/.config/cargo-ai/credentials.json`.
|
|
49
|
+
|
|
50
|
+
The CLI ships with a built-in OAuth client, so no setup is required. Advanced users can override the provider via `--client-id`, `--domain`, and `--audience`.
|
|
51
|
+
|
|
52
|
+
### Workspace selection
|
|
53
|
+
|
|
54
|
+
API tokens (`--token`) are workspace-scoped, so the workspace is implicit and nothing is persisted alongside the token.
|
|
55
|
+
|
|
56
|
+
OAuth sessions (`--oauth`) are user-scoped, so after authentication the CLI picks a default workspace and saves it next to the token:
|
|
57
|
+
|
|
58
|
+
- **One workspace**: it is selected automatically.
|
|
59
|
+
- **Multiple workspaces**: you are prompted to pick one (in a TTY); in non-interactive shells the CLI prints the list and asks you to re-run with `--workspace-uuid <uuid>`.
|
|
60
|
+
|
|
61
|
+
Pass `cargo-ai login --oauth --workspace-uuid <uuid>` to skip the prompt. `CARGO_WORKSPACE_UUID` (or per-command `--workspace-uuid` flags where supported) overrides the saved default at runtime.
|
|
62
|
+
|
|
42
63
|
### Environment variables (override)
|
|
43
64
|
|
|
44
65
|
Environment variables take precedence over saved credentials, useful for CI or temporary overrides.
